Analysis

Zambia recorded 57.0% for population ages 15-64 in 2025. That is the highest value across all 66 years on record.

Compared with earlier readings it is up 0.8% on the previous year and up 7.4% over ten years.

Over the whole period, population ages 15-64 in Zambia peaked at 57.0% in 2025 and was at its lowest, 47.4%, in 1980.

That places Zambia 191st out of 217 countries with data for 2025, putting it in the bottom qu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 66 years of available data.

Averages by decade

DecadeAverage LowestHighest Years
1960s 50.4% 49.8% 51.1% 10
1970s 48.3% 47.4% 49.6% 10
1980s 48.0% 47.4% 48.6% 10
1990s 49.1% 48.7% 49.4% 10
2000s 50.7% 49.6% 51.7% 10
2010s 53.0% 51.9% 54.5% 10
2020s 55.9% 54.9% 57.0% 6

Total population between the ages 15 to 64 as a percentage of the total population. Population is based on the de facto definition of population, which counts all residents regardless of legal status or citizenship.
